TANGO PERFORMANCES have included the participation of world renown bandoneon virtuosos DAVID ALSINA and RAUL JAURENA.

Actor GABRIELLA CAVALLERO of the Tony award winner Denver Center Theatre Company, presents an engaging history of the tango. In addition to her acting career, Ms Cavallero teaches at the University of Colorado and has recorded more than 200 books for the Library of Congress program for the blind.
(http://www.ihearvoicepeople.com/gabriellacavallero.html)

TANGO TIMES, a favorite of audiences, has been performed at York, Pennsylvania at the Latin American Arts Festival, at Saint Mary's College of Maryland, and the Ohio University at Athens. Most recently the group was featured at the 2002 Benefit for Argentina at the Shriver Hall of the Johns Hopkins University. Tango Times features dancers TINO & SUSAN, winners of the Kennedy Center 2002 Dance Project for the Millennium Stage.
